Forbes calculated Johnny Depp to be Hollywood’s second highest paid actor in 2012, earning $30million. In the latest in our series on celebrity money, we look at how Depp made his millions.

He may have played some strange roles but Depp's got his head screwed on when it comes to cash.

Born in 1963, the actor first became a teen idol due to his role on 1980s TV show 21 Jump Street.

Johnny Depp playing Captain Jack Sparrow in 2006

He soon moved to the big screen, specialising in quirky oddball characters such as the title characters in Edward Scissorhands and What's Eating Gilbert Grape?

Depp is one of the highest paid actors in the world; his annual salary varies from $30million to $100million thanks to many of his successful films. In particular Pirates of the Caribbean, which has contributed to a yearly box office gross of around $7.6.billion worldwide.

Other box office success added to his coffers, including roles in Sleepy Hollow, Charlie and the Chocolate Factory and the hugely successful Pirates of the Caribbean series – the first three films grossed more than $2.7billion (£1.65billion). 

Depp was paid £21million to reprise his role as Captain Jack Sparrow in the fourth Pirates of the Caribbean film On Stranger Tides, released last year. It made him the highest earner that year but failed to surpass the £38million paid to Harrison Ford to come back for a fourth Indiana Jones film.

However, Depp, the son of a waitress and a civil engineer, came from humble beginnings.

His family moved more than 20 times during his childhood before settling in Florida. Family problems led him to self-harm as a child.

His parents divorced when Depp was a teenager and soon after he dropped out of school to become a rock star.

After modest local success with various bands he started to concentrate on his acting career.  

Despite being known for shunning publicity, Depp's personal life has hit the headlines on numerous occasions.

He had a short-lived marriage to a make-up artist in the 1980s and went on to date actresses Winona Ryder, Sherilyn Fenn and Jennifer Gray, as well as model Kate Moss.

Between 1993 and 2004, Depp part owned the Viper Room nightclub in Hollywood, made infamous after fellow actor River Phoenix died of a drug overdose in 1993.

In 1998 Depp began dating Vanessa Paradis, the couple where together for 14 years until they amicably split earlier this month. 

Paradis, 39, and Depp, 49, never exchanged vows, but Depp has decided to hand over half of his fortune to the mother of his two children. This is set to be one of the biggest pay-offs between a non-married couple. The speculations is that Vanessa will receive more than $150million. 

As part of his quest for privacy, in 2004 Depp bought a private island in the Caribbean for $3.6million (£2.2million).  Little Halls Pond Cay is about 60 miles south of Nassau in the protected Exuma Land and Sea Park.

Depp has properties in LA, Hawaii and England and earlier this year snapped up the Palazzo DonĂ  Sangiantoffetti Palace in Venice, Italy for a reported $13.8million (£8.4million).

Depp is clearly rich and handsome but he also demonstrates compassion. In 2008 he donated $2million (£1.3million) to Great Ormond Street Hospital after his daughter Lily-Rose, then aged eight, was treated for kidney failure there. 

In 2009, he played Heath Ledger's character in The Imaginarium of Dr Parnassus after Ledger died following an accidental overdose. 

Alongside Jude Law and Colin Farrell, Depp donated his fee for the film to Ledger's daughter Matilda who was left out of her father's original will.
